|
1. Algoritmning maqsadi va tushunchasi haqida tushuntirish Deykstra algoritmi qanday ishlaydi? Deykstriyaning eng qisqa yo’l algoritmi
|
bet | 7/7 | Sana | 15.05.2024 | Hajmi | 46,46 Kb. | | #234563 |
Bog'liq sarviiiiii6.Xulosa
Dijkstra va Prim algoritmlari koʻplab axborot tizimlarida foydalaniladigan algoritmlardir. Dijkstra algoritmi bir grafda eng koʻproq yoki aqlli yoʻnalishni aniqlash uchun ishlatiladi. Prim algoritmi esa bir grafda minimum kasrni aniqlash uchun ishlatiladi.
Prima Dijkstra algoritmi koʻplab masalalarda foydalaniladi, masalan, transport tizimida eng qisqa yoʻl aniqlash, mahalliy hukumatlar uchun hududlarni aniqlash va optimallashtirish, va bank xizmatlari taqdim etish uchun kredit boʻlimini optimallashtirish. Algoritmning qulayligi va tezligi sababli, u koʻplab sohalarda ilgʻor foydalaniladi.
Shuningdek, Dijkstra va Prim algoritmlari dasturiy taʼlimda ham koʻp foydalaniladigan algoritmlardir. Bu algoritmlarni tushunish, oʻrganish va amalga oshirish, dasturchilar uchun koʻplab imkoniyatlar yaratadi
Dijkstra algoritmi bir necha sohalarda foydalaniladigan koʻp yoʻnalishli bir algoritm hisoblanadi. Ushbu algoritm koʻplab muammolarni hal qilish uchun qoʻllaniladi, masalan, yoʻl qidirish, transport va tarmoq tuzilishida kerakli resurslarni aniqlash, bank xizmatlarini taqdim etish, mahalliy hukumatlar uchun hududlarni aniqlash va optimallashtirish, elektron pochta xabarlari tarqatish va boshqa. Algoritmda bir nechta axborot strukturalari, shuningdek, maslahat kataloglari, taxminiy jadval, qirqinchi matn, taxminiy koʻzni oʻtkazuvchi koʻrsatkichlar, va boshqalar ishlatiladi. Algoritmdagi xatoliklarning tuzatilishi uchun avvalgi koʻrsatkichlarni tekshirish, kodni tozalash, va input xatoliklarini aniqlash uchun keng foydalaniladi. Praktikada Dijkstra algoritmi koʻplab xil sohalarda foydalaniladi, shuningdek, transport, tarmoq tuzilish, bank xizmatlari, mahalliy hukumatlar, informatika, moddalar va boshqa.
7. Foydalanilgan adabiyotlar
1. Кленберг Дж.,Тардос Е.”Алгоритмы.Разработка и применение”.2016г.
2. Кормен Т.,Лейзерсон Ч.,Ривест Р.«Алгоритмы.Построение и анализ»,2013г.
3. Колдаев. Основы_алгоритмизации_и программирования. 2013 г.
4. Г.Уоррен «Алгоритмические трюки для программистов», 2014 г.
"Introduction to Algorithms" by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ein
"Algorithms" by Robert Sedgewick and Kevin Wayne
"The Algorithm Design Manual" by Steven S. Skiena
GeeksforGeeks.org
Brilliant.org
Khan Academy
Hackerearth.com
Topcoder.com
Leetcode.com
Bu adabiyotlar va saytlar Dijkstra algoritmi haqida qulay va oʻqituvchi maqolalar, kod namunalari, misollar va mashqlar taqdim etadi. Shuningdek, bu resurslar Dijkstra algoritmini tushunish va amalga oshirishga yordam beruvchi bir nechta ilgʻor vazifalarni ham oʻz ichiga oladi.
|
|
Bosh sahifa
Aloqalar
Bosh sahifa
1. Algoritmning maqsadi va tushunchasi haqida tushuntirish Deykstra algoritmi qanday ishlaydi? Deykstriyaning eng qisqa yo’l algoritmi
|